Transaction edfec55cb73fb55f46055769c6a3c71f5a2a0df6d786a08d74b4cf91ca501788
1 Input
1 Output
-
edfec55cb73fb55f46055769c6a3c71f5a2a0df6d786a08d74b4cf91ca501788:0
- value
- 4987262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ec20ead5b02afde83fabc202f992b8d759ea6aee OP_EQUAL
- address
- 3PDYpx8twG3a6Q6jivD4wS7rirJArtqWEb